WARTBURG'S CONLON NAMED NSCAA WEST REGION COACH OF THE YEAR

January 9, 2007
Release courtesy of Mark Adkins, Wartburg College sports information director

CEDAR RAPIDS , IOWA . . . Wartburg College head men’s soccer coach Jim Conlon has been named the National Soccer Coaches Association Division III West Region Coach of the Year. Conlon’s 2006 team continued a strong recent run for the Knights, registering a 19-3-1 record, third consecutive Iowa Conference title, third league postseason tournament championship in the last four seasons and fifth consecutive 10-win plus campaign. The Knights have been NCAA Division III national tournament qualifiers for four straight seasons and made the round of 16 in each of the last three tourneys. Over the last four seasons, they have tallied a 71-13-6 record.

A two-time Iowa Intercollegiate Conference men’s Coach of the Year, Conlon’s record at Wartburg, through seven seasons, is 92-43-8.

Conlon will receive the West Region Coach of the Year award at the annual national convention banquet in Indianapolis, Ind., Friday evening, Jan. 12. The NSCAA will announce its national Coach of the Year recipients for each division at that time.
